A) Part of gas-exchange system, exchange both \[C{{O}_{2}}\] and \[{{O}_{2}};\] increase surface area for diffusion.
B) Used by water breathers; based on countercurrent exchange; use negative pressure breathing.
C) Exchange only \[{{O}_{2}};\] are associated with a circulatory system; found in vertebrates.
D) Found in insects; employ positive-pressure pumping based on crosscurrent flow.
Correct Answer: A
Solution :
[a] The external gill, tracheae, and lungs are all examples of gas-exchange systems used by various animals to exchange both \[C{{O}_{2}}\] and \[{{O}_{2}}.\] One of the special properties of all respiratory systems is that they increase surface area for diffusion.You need to login to perform this action.
